Miranda Lambert and Brendan McLoughlin started their romance the "old-school" way, which was "mind-blowing" for the country star's husband due to their age gap.
According to Taste of Country, Lambert has previously shared that she met her now-husband on the set of "Good Morning America" in 2019. According to the outlet, her bandmate Angaleena Presley was the first to spot her now-husband and referred to him as the "hot cop." "We wrote each other literal letters, like, old-school. I was like, 'Do you wanna be pen pals?' He was like, 'Letters with a pen?'...He's eight years younger, so that was really mind-blowing to him."
